Xenia vs. Ksenia vs. Yesenia

Hey, I’ve recently found myself drawn to these names, or should I say "this", as they are just different versions (Greek, Eastern European and Spanish respectively) of the same name, but sometimes...they seem to foreign (Ksenia/Yesenia) or rough (Xenia) to me. I wonder if you could think of names that have the same sound and feel to them, or maybe nicknames to these ones? Thanks!
